Khirbat al Mawāsī
Khirbat al Mawāsī is a ruin in West Bank, Palestine. Khirbat al Mawāsī is situated nearby to the village Geva’ot Olam, as well as near the hamlet Yanun.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Aqraba
Town
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Aqraba is a Palestinian town in the Nablus Governorate, located eighteen kilometers southeast of Nablus in the northern West Bank. According to the Palestinian Central Bureau of Statistics, Aqraba had a population of 10,024 inhabitants in 2017. Aqraba is situated 3 km southeast of Khirbat al Mawāsī.
